Panasonic ZS20 vs Sony NEX-5R Overview

Let's look closer at the Panasonic ZS20 versus Sony NEX-5R, one being a Small Sensor Superzoom and the latter is a Entry-Level Mirrorless by companies Panasonic and Sony. The resolution of the ZS20 (14MP) and the NEX-5R (16MP) is pretty comparable but the ZS20 (1/2.3") and NEX-5R (APS-C) boast totally different sensor dimensions.

Panasonic ZS20 vs Sony NEX-5R Physical Comparison

If you are aiming to lug around your camera often, you'll need to take into account its weight and volume. The Panasonic ZS20 has outside measurements of 105mm x 59mm x 28mm (4.1" x 2.3" x 1.1") having a weight of 206 grams (0.45 lbs) and the Sony NEX-5R has sizing of 111mm x 59mm x 39mm (4.4" x 2.3" x 1.5") and a weight of 276 grams (0.61 lbs).

Panasonic ZS20 vs Sony NEX-5R Sensor Comparison

Quite often, it is very hard to envision the contrast in sensor measurements merely by checking out specifications. The visual underneath might give you a stronger sense of the sensor sizing in the ZS20 and NEX-5R.

Plainly, both of the cameras feature different megapixels and different sensor measurements. The ZS20 with its smaller sensor will make achieving bokeh tougher and the Sony NEX-5R will provide greater detail using its extra 2MP. Higher resolution can also help you crop shots way more aggressively.
